Ordinals
beta
Sat 1322800300637998
decimal
319120.300637998
degree
0°109120′592″300637998‴
percentile
62.9904905758609%
name
emcseckfwwp
cycle
0
epoch
1
period
158
block
319120
offset
300637998
timestamp
2014-09-04 21:02:28 UTC
rarity
common
prev
next